Transaction 82054c379672a3e64ef93b7224a4462bf1feaa7fd0f7334bdea9d764539fe9ab

32 Input
2 Outputs
  • 82054c379672a3e64ef93b7224a4462bf1feaa7fd0f7334bdea9d764539fe9ab:0
  • value  20127234
    address  16Z8xHAKTLp3Jy64q9C3UPuEuMr45WrLwK
  • 82054c379672a3e64ef93b7224a4462bf1feaa7fd0f7334bdea9d764539fe9ab:1
  • value  1000012
    address  1EiRxnsUJ2QC6HNTZutYPZ8cap2wDwqE8x